Activer la mise à l’échelle automatique dans App Service

Effectué

Dans cette unité, vous allez apprendre à activer la mise à l’échelle automatique, à créer des règles de mise à l’échelle automatique et à surveiller l’activité de mise à l’échelle automatique

Activer la mise à l’échelle automatique

Pour commencer avec la mise à l'échelle automatique, accédez à votre plan App Service dans le portail Azure et sélectionnez Mise à l'échelle (plan App Service) dans le groupe Paramètres de dans le volet de navigation à gauche.

Note

Tous les niveaux tarifaires ne prennent pas en charge la mise à l’échelle automatique. Les niveaux tarifaires de développement sont limités à une seule instance (les niveaux F1 et D1) ou fournissent uniquement une mise à l’échelle manuelle (le niveau B1). Si vous avez sélectionné l’un de ces niveaux, vous devez d’abord augmenter l'échelle vers le S1 ou l’un des niveaux de production P.

Par défaut, un plan App Service implémente uniquement la mise à l’échelle manuelle. La sélection de l'option Mise à l'échelle automatique personnalisée révèle des groupes de conditions que vous pouvez utiliser pour gérer vos paramètres de mise à l'échelle.

Activation de la mise à l’échelle automatique

Ajouter des conditions d’échelle

Une fois que vous avez activé la mise à l’échelle automatique, vous pouvez modifier la condition d’échelle par défaut créée automatiquement et ajouter vos propres conditions d’échelle personnalisées. N’oubliez pas que chaque condition de mise à l’échelle peut être mise à l’échelle en fonction d’une métrique ou d’une mise à l’échelle vers un nombre d’instances spécifique.

La condition d’échelle par défaut est exécutée quand aucune des autres conditions d’échelle n’est active.

la page de condition d’un plan App Service affichant la condition d’échelle par défaut.

Une condition d’échelle basée sur les métriques peut également spécifier le nombre minimal et maximal d’instances à créer. Le nombre maximal ne peut pas dépasser les limites définies par le niveau tarifaire. En outre, toutes les conditions d’échelle autres que la valeur par défaut peuvent inclure une planification indiquant quand la condition doit être appliquée.

Créer des règles de mise à l’échelle

Une condition de mise à l’échelle basée sur des métriques contient une ou plusieurs règles d’échelle. Vous utilisez le lien Ajouter une règle pour ajouter vos propres règles personnalisées. Vous définissez les critères qui indiquent quand une règle doit déclencher une action de mise à l’échelle automatique, ainsi que l'action à exécuter (augmentation de capacité ou réduction de capacité) en utilisant les métriques, agrégations, opérateurs et seuils décrits précédemment.

volet Paramètres de règle d’échelle.

Surveiller l’activité de mise à l’échelle automatique

Le portail Azure vous permet de suivre le moment où la mise à l’échelle automatique s’est produite via le graphique de l'historique des exécutions . Ce graphique montre comment le nombre d’instances varie au fil du temps et quelles conditions de mise à l’échelle automatique ont provoqué chaque modification.

Les informations d’historique des exécutions de l’application.

Vous pouvez utiliser le graphique de l'historique des exécutions avec les métriques affichées sur la page Vue d’ensemble pour mettre en corrélation les événements de mise à l’échelle automatique avec l’utilisation des ressources.

Les métriques affichées dans la page vue d’ensemble du plan App Service.